Hyderabad: World Economic Forum (WEF) has extended an invitation to Industries Minister KT Rama Rao to attend its Annual Meeting 2022, which will take place in Davos-Klosters from January 17 to 21.

Appreciating the Minister’s work, WEF president Borge Brende, said, “Your leadership and commitment to transforming Telangana into a leading technology powerhouse is noteworthy. As India emerges from the impacts of the COVID-19 pandemic, its ability to quickly adapt to innovation and emerging technologies will be vital for a sustainable economic recovery. Your insights on harnessing emerging technologies for common good will be key to the discussions at the Annual Meeting.”


He also stated that it was essential for the world’s foremost political, business, and civil society leaders to come together once again to restore trust in the ability to shape the future in collaborative ways.

Minister KT Rama Rao expressed happiness over receiving an invitation to the prestigious WEF annual meeting in 2020. “I see this invitation as a recognition of Telangana government’s initiatives in the fields of information technology, industry, and innovation,” he said.

The Minister further stated that this was another opportunity for Telangana to showcase its friendly industrial policies and immense scope for global firms to invest in the State. The Minister thanked the WEF organizers for the invitation.
